首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 开发语言 > C++ >

关于CString类与整数之间的相互转换,该怎么解决

2012-02-04 
关于CString类与整数之间的相互转换定义一个CStringstr{ 0x0d1192 }我现在想把 0x0d1192 转化为一个

关于CString类与整数之间的相互转换
定义一个CString   str   =   { "0x0d1192 "};
我现在想把 "0x0d1192 "转化为一个整数   int   i;。
之后再int   j   =i+1;
在把j转化为一个16进制型的串 "0x0D1193 "。放到一个CString中。
如何实现。


[解决办法]
CString 操作指南:
http://blog.csdn.net/jixingzhong/archive/2006/11/14/1383146.aspx
[解决办法]
CString str = _T( "0x0d1192 ");
int i = _tcstoul(str, 0, 16);
int j = i + 1;
CString str1;
str1.Format(_T( "0x%x "),j);

热点排行